Drawing Formula of Torispherical Dishend

Step 1
This instruction is given by following ASME code.


Step 1: Draw a line equal to the diameter of shell.


Step 2: Draw the skirt on both end of the diameter.

Step 3: Connect the two ends of skirt.

Step 4: Calculate the inside corner radius by using following formula.
Icr=0.06 x Inside Diameter of Shell
Step 5:  From one of the ends of skirt draw a circle with a radius equal to icr calculated above.

Step 6: This circle cuts the connection line of two ends of skirt at a point name it B. From point B, draw a circle with a radius equal to (shell radius-icr) and draw a vertical line at the midpoint of the line drawn at step 1. This vertical line and the circle will intersect at a point and it is the center point of the dished circle.

Step 7: Draw a circle using the center point found in step 6 with the shell radius or dish radius.

Step 8: Draw a circle from point B with a radius equal to icr.

Step 9: Trim all the lines except the lines shown in figure beside.

Step 10: Mirror the lines as like figure.



Now you are done & get a ASME standard ToriSpherical Dishend. All the dimension found in this drawing will be ASME standard Torispherical dishend.
